1
Use your hands to break up the chocolate bar.
2
Melt in the microwave together with the butter for 1-1:30 minutes.
3
Use a spoon to mix it as it melts.
4
Combine the eggs and flour in a bowl and mix well.
5
When it becomes white and free of lumps, it's ready.
6
Quickly mix it together with a whisk.
7
Mix Steps 1 and 2 together, then fill the ramekins 80% full.
8
Place in a preheated oven and bake for 5 minutes.
9
It's already done.
10
Wow!
11
Serve while hot!
12
You can use any kind of chocolate you like, but I recommend you use bitter chocolate as it gives a deeper flavor If you'd like it to be sweeter, use some sugar.
13
This one uses 2 coffee creamers in place of butter for a low fat version.

You need 4 ingredients. The key ingredients include: 1 Chocolate bar (I recommend bitter), 2 Eggs, 3 tbsp Butter (or margarine), 1 heaping tablespoon Cake flour.
